1 Features
Key features of the Reference Design include:
- Three-Phase Motor Control Power Stage
- DC Bus Current Feedback for Overcurrent Protection
- DC Bus Voltage Feedback for Overvoltage Protection
- Phase Voltage Feedback to Implement Sensorless Trapezoidal Control
- ICSP™ Header for Interfacing to a Microchip Programmer/Debugger
- UART Communication Header
- CAN interface (CAN transceiver is part of dsPIC33CDVC256MP506)
